5 Fun and Effective Exercise Routines for Foodies: Balancing Diet and Fitness

 5 Fun and Effective Exercise Routines for Foodies

Balancing Diet and Fitness


As the old saying goes, "You are what you eat," and when it comes to maintaining a healthy body and mind, this rings incredibly true. However, with the abundance of delicious food options available, it can be hard to stick to a nutritious diet. That's where exercise comes in - the perfect way to balance out those extra calories and simultaneously boost your energy levels.


If you're a foodie looking for fun and effective ways to get in shape, we've got you covered. Here are five exercise routines that are perfect for those who love to indulge in culinary delights:


1. Yoga

Not only is yoga an excellent way to reduce stress, it also helps you build strength and flexibility. If you're a beginner, start with gentle yoga poses, such as the Downward-Facing Dog or the Child's Pose, before moving on to more challenging sequences like the Sun Salutation.


2. Group Fitness Class

Joining a group fitness class is a great way to socialize with like-minded individuals and get a killer workout at the same time. Whether you're into kickboxing, Zumba, or spinning, there's sure to be a class that suits your interests.


3. Hiking

If you're lucky enough to live near a national park or hiking trail, take advantage of the opportunity to explore the great outdoors while getting some exercise. Not only is hiking a great workout, it's also a fantastic way to connect with nature and reduce stress.


4. Swimming

Swimming is a low-impact exercise that's great for those who suffer from joint pain or injuries. Not only does it work out your entire body, it's also a refreshing activity to do during the hot summer months.


5. Dancing

If you're a lover of music, why not incorporate that into your exercise routine? Dancing is not only a fun way to sweat it out, it's also a great way to improve your coordination and balance.
